What Is Ginseng and Why Does It Matter?

Ginseng is a medicinal root derived from plants in the Panax family. Rich in active compounds called ginsenosides, ginseng has been used for thousands of years in Eastern medicine to improve stamina, concentration, and immunity.

Now, it’s gaining popularity in the West not just as a general tonic, but for its potential effects on metabolism, glucose control, and fat loss.

Ginseng for Blood Sugar Control

One of the strongest areas of ginseng research involves its ability to regulate blood sugar levels, a crucial factor in effective weight loss.

Here’s how ginseng may help:

  • Improves insulin sensitivity, making it easier for your body to manage blood glucose efficiently.
  • Reduces post-meal blood sugar spikes, which can prevent cravings and fat storage.
  • Supports glucose uptake intomuscle cells, promoting better energy usage.

How to Use Ginseng Properly

If you’re considering adding ginseng to your wellness routine, here are a few tips:

  • Take it in the morning or early afternoon to support daily energy and metabolism.
  • Start with a moderate dose (200–400 mg per day), especially if you’re new to herbal supplements.
  • Look for standardized extracts that clearly list the ginsenoside content.
  • If you’re combining ginseng with other supplements, make sure there’s no overlap with medications you’re taking, especially for blood sugar or blood pressure.

Ginseng can be consumed as a tea, capsule, tincture, or powder, but many people prefer convenient blends that combine ginseng with other supportive ingredients.
